Ge Yan has authored 48 papers that have received a total of 1.6k indexed citations.
This includes 29 papers in Civil and Structural Engineering, 18 papers in Mechanical Engineering and 10 papers in Electrical and Electronic Engineering. The topics of these papers are Vibration Control and Rheological Fluids (22 papers), Structural Engineering and Vibration Analysis (18 papers) and Seismic Performance and Analysis (15 papers). Ge Yan is often cited by papers focused on Vibration Control and Rheological Fluids (22 papers), Structural Engineering and Vibration Analysis (18 papers) and Seismic Performance and Analysis (15 papers) and collaborates with scholars based in China, United Kingdom and Russia. Ge Yan's co-authors include Lin‐Chuan Zhao, Wenming Zhang, Hong‐Xiang Zou, Zhiyuan Wu and Wen-Hao Qi and has published in prestigious journals such as Applied Physics Letters, Applied Energy and Nano Energy.
